In normal rats callosal projections in striate cortex connect retinotopically corresponding, nonmirror-symmetric cortical loci, whereas in rats bilaterally enucleated at birth, callosal fibers connect topographically mismatched, mirror-symmetric loci. Moreover, retina input specifies the topography of callosal projections by postnatal day (P)6. To investigate whether retinal input guides development of callosal maps by promoting either the corrective pruning of exuberant axon branches or the specific ingrowth and elaboration of axon branches at topographically correct places, we studied the topography of emerging callosal connections at and immediately after P6. After restricted intracortical injections of anterogradely and retrogradely transported tracers we observed that the normal, nonmirror-symmetric callosal map, as well as the anomalous, mirror-symmetric map observed in neonatally enucleated animals, are present by P6-7, just as collateral branches of simple architecture emerge from their parental axons and grow into superficial cortical layers. Our results therefore do not support the idea that retinal input guides callosal map formation by primarily promoting the large-scale elimination of long, nontopographic branches and arbors. Instead, they suggest that retinal input specifies the sites on the parental axons from which interstitial branches will grow to invade middle and upper cortical layers, thereby ensuring that the location of invading interstitial branches is accurately related to the topographical location of the soma that gives rise to the parental axon. Moreover, our results from enucleated rats suggest that the cues that determine the mirror-symmetric callosal map exert only a weak control on the topography of fiber ingrowth.  相似文献

Background

In selected patients with rectal cancer, laparoscopic surgery is as safe as open surgery, with similar resection margins and completeness of resection. In addition, recovery is faster after laparoscopic surgery. We analyzed long-term outcomes in a group of patients with locally advanced rectal cancer (LARC) treated with preoperative therapy followed by laparoscopic surgery and intraoperative electron-beam radiotherapy (IOERT).

Methods and materials

From June 2005 to December 2010, 125 LARC patients were treated with 2 induction courses of FOLFOX-4 (oxaliplatin 85 mg/m2/d1, intravenous leucovorin at 200 mg/m2/d1–2, and an intravenous bolus of 5-fluorouracil 400 mg/m2/d1–2) and preoperative chemoradiation (4,500–5,040 cGy) followed by total mesorectal excision (laparoscopic, 35 %; open surgery, 65 %) and a presacral boost with IOERT.

Results

Patients in the laparoscopic surgery group lost less blood (median 200 vs 350 mL, p < 0.01) and had a shorter hospital stay (7 vs 11 days; p = 0.02) than those in the open surgery group. Laparoscopic procedures were shorter than open surgery procedures (270 vs 302 min; p = 0.67). Postoperative morbidity (32 vs 44 %; p = 0.65), RTOG grade ≥3 acute toxicity (25 vs 25 %; p = 0.97), and RTOG grade ≥3 chronic toxicity (7 vs 9 %; p = 0.48) were similar in the laparoscopy and open surgery groups. The median follow-up time for the entire cohort of patients was 59.5 months (range 7.8–90); no significant differences were observed between the groups in locoregional control (HR 0.91, p = 0.89), disease-free survival (HR 0.80, p = 0.65), and overall survival (HR 0.67, p = 0.52).

Conclusions

Postchemoradiation laparoscopically assisted IOERT is feasible, with an acceptable risk of postoperative complications, shorter hospital stay, and similar long-term outcomes when compared to the open surgery approach.  相似文献

Abstract

Introduction: Along with increased life expectancy, the proportion of elderly patients with choledocholithiasis will increase and with this, the need for endoscopic cholangiopancreatography (ERCP). Current recommendations suggest laparoscopic cholecystectomy in all patients with choledocholithiasis to prevent biliary events. However, adherence to these recommendations is low, especially in older patients.

Methods: Retrospective study that included non-cholecystectomized patients aged >?=75 years who underwent ERCP for choledocholithiasis from 2013–2016 (n?=?131). A new biliary event was defined as the need for a new ERCP, cholecystitis, cholangitis or gallstone pancreatitis.

Aim: The aim of this study was to compare the outcomes of new biliary events and mortality in cholecystectomized vs non-cholecystectomized patients after ERCP.

Results: Cholecystectomy was performed in 22% of the patients (92% laparoscopic). The post-cholecystectomy complication rate was 13% and the mortality rate was 7%. During the follow-up period (669?±?487 days) a new biliary event occurred in 20% of patients - 10% new ERCP, 9% cholecystitis, 9% cholangitis and 2% pancreatitis. Cholecystectomized patients had fewer events (7% vs 24%, p?=?.048) and longer time to event (p?=?.016). There was no statistically significant difference in all-cause mortality (14% vs 27%, p?=?.13), mortality related to lithiasis (0% vs 9%, p?=?.11) or time to mortality from all causes (p?=?.07) and related to biliary events (p?=?.07).

Conclusions: In this group of elderly patients, cholecystectomy after ERCP prevented the occurrence of new biliary events but resulted in a non-statistically significant difference in mortality.  相似文献

OBJECTIVES: To provide an introduction to the legal concepts that are involved in negligence suits involving oncology nurses. DATA SOURCES: Medline, Lexis, Westlaw, legal literature and texts. CONCLUSIONS: To avoid liability and guard against negligence or malpractice suits, the oncology nurse must be aware of the legal responsibilities of each aspect of the nursing role. IMPLICATIONS FOR NURSING PRACTICE: Protecting yourself against medical malpractice begins by understanding terms and concepts that are essential in instituting legal action against the nurse and incorporating the appropriate risk reduction practices into daily practice.  相似文献

Ultrasonography is a powerful nonionizing imaging modality that has generally been underused by American Urologists in the past. Innovative investigators and clinicians, however, are realizing the great potential of ultrasonography and are applying it increasingly not only in the clinic but in the operating room. In this commentary we outline some of the current and future uses of intraoperative ultrasonography in urologic oncology.  相似文献

Background.

The need for preoperative chemoradiation or short-course radiation in all T3 rectal tumors is a controversial issue. A multicenter phase II trial was undertaken to evaluate the efficacy and safety of neoadjuvant capecitabine and oxaliplatin combined with bevacizumab in patients with intermediate-risk rectal adenocarcinoma.

Methods.

We recruited 46 patients with T3 rectal adenocarcinoma selected by magnetic resonance imaging (MRI) who were candidates for (R0) resection located in the middle third with clear mesorectal fascia and who were selected by pelvic MRI. Patients received four cycles of neoadjuvant capecitabine and oxaliplatin combined with bevacizumab (final cycle without bevacizumab) before total mesorectal excision (TME). In case of progression, preoperative chemoradiation was planned. The primary endpoint was overall response rate (ORR).

Results.

On an intent-to-treat analysis, the ORR was 78% (n = 36; 95% confidence interval [CI]: 63%–89%) and no progression was detected. Pathologic complete response was observed in nine patients (20%; 95% CI: 9–33), and T downstaging was observed in 48%. Forty-four patients proceeded to TME, and all had R0 resection. During preoperative therapy, two deaths occurred as a result of pulmonary embolism and diarrhea, respectively, and one patient died after surgery as a result of peritonitis secondary to an anastomotic leak (AL). A 13% rate of AL was higher than expected. The 24-month disease-free survival rate was 75% (95% CI: 60%–85%), and the 2-year local relapse rate was 2% (95% CI: 0%–11%).

Conclusion.

In this selected population, initial chemotherapy results in promising activity, but the observed toxicity does not support further investigation of this specific regimen. Nevertheless, these early results warrant further testing of this strategy in an enriched population and in randomized trials.  相似文献

Objective

The purpose of this preliminary study was to determine feasibility of a clinical trial to measure the effects of manual therapy on sternocleidomastoid active trigger points (TrPs) in patients with cervicogenic headache (CeH).

Methods

Twenty patients, 7 males and 13 females (mean ± SD age, 39 ± 13 years), with a clinical diagnosis of CeH and active TrPs in the sternocleidomastoid muscle were randomly divided into 2 groups. One group received TrP therapy (manual pressure applied to taut bands and passive stretching), and the other group received simulated TrP therapy (after TrP localization no additional pressure was added, and inclusion of longitudinal stroking but no additional stretching). The primary outcome was headache intensity (numeric pain scale) based on the headaches experienced in the preceding week. Secondary outcomes included neck pain intensity, cervical range of motion (CROM), pressure pain thresholds (PPT) over the upper cervical spine joints and deep cervical flexors motor performance. Outcomes were captured at baseline and 1 week after the treatment.

Results

Patients receiving TrP therapy showed greater reduction in headache and neck pain intensity than those receiving the simulation (P < .001). Patients receiving the TrP therapy experienced greater improvements in motor performance of the deep cervical flexors, active CROM, and PPT (all, P < .001) than those receiving the simulation. Between-groups effect sizes were large (all, standardized mean difference, > 0.84).

Conclusion

This study provides preliminary evidence that a trial of this nature is feasible. The preliminary findings show that manual therapy targeted to active TrPs in the sternocleidomastoid muscle may be effective for reducing headache and neck pain intensity and increasing motor performance of the deep cervical flexors, PPT, and active CROM in individuals with CeH showing active TrPs in this muscle. Studies including greater sample sizes and examining long-term effects are needed.  相似文献
